svelte-material-ui
svelte-material-ui copied to clipboard
Impossible to import "@smui/data-table" in version 6.0.0-beta.16
Describe the bug I followed the documentation and tried to see tooltips. The app just crash.
Similar to #471 & #474
To Reproduce Steps to reproduce the behavior:
- Install the package
npm i -D @smui/tooltip
- Add line
import DataTable, { Head, Body, Cell } from '@smui/data-table';
in tag script - See the 500 error
Expected behavior I expect the import to work ^^.
Details error
500
Unexpected token 'export'
/Users/dblk/[...]/src/ui/node_modules/@material/animation/util.js:62
export function getCorrectPropertyName(windowObj, cssProperty) {
^^^^^^
SyntaxError: Unexpected token 'export'
at Object.compileFunction (node:vm:352:18)
at wrapSafe (node:internal/modules/cjs/loader:1033:15)
at Module._compile (node:internal/modules/cjs/loader:1069:27)
at Object.Module._extensions..js (node:internal/modules/cjs/loader:1159:10)
at Module.load (node:internal/modules/cjs/loader:981:32)
at Function.Module._load (node:internal/modules/cjs/loader:822:12)
at ModuleWrap.<anonymous> (node:internal/modules/esm/translators:170:29)
at ModuleJob.run (node:internal/modules/esm/module_job:198:25)
at async Promise.all (index 0)
at async ESMLoader.import (node:internal/modules/esm/loader:385:24)
Desktop
- OS: Mac Os
- Browser: Chrome
- Version: 102
- svelte-kit, 1.0.0-next.350
- I use Typescript
- Nodes: v16.15.1
- svelte: 3.44.0
- npm: 8.12.1
+1
a temporary fix is to use 6.0.0-beta.15